Our hospitality team in training for Sheffield 10k challenge

Our hospitality team are busy on their feet every day delivering meals and drinks to patients and families. 

But instead of sitting back and relaxing after a long shift, they’re swapping sensible shoes for trainers and hitting the road as they prepare to join the start line of the Sheffield 10k and raise vital funds for our patient care. 

Hospitality assistant Lucy Gibson encouraged colleagues Tracey Kendall, Martha Saxelby Newall and Samantha Taylor to join her for the popular September 29 sporting challenge. 

Tracy was so keen to sign up that she changed her holiday plans to accommodate the race and is also requesting donations to St Luke’s in lieu of gifts for her birthday. 

And the fundraising bug has also bitten Martha, who is planning a dance class at her dance gym, Dance Fusion UK, to raise extra cash, while Samantha is taking on the famous Great North Run and Lucy herself is planning an extra fundraising day at the Meadowhead branch of Morrison’s supermarket on September 14. 

"It's not about winning the race, it's about setting yourself a challenge and making a difference,” said Lucy. 

“Seeing the impact St Luke's has on patients and their families first hand makes it all worthwhile. 

“The atmosphere on the day is just incredible knowing everyone is there to support important causes and we’re all excited to be part of such a great event.”
